Market Overview
The Automatic Number Plate Recognition Systems Market is expanding rapidly as governments, transportation authorities, and commercial enterprises increasingly adopt intelligent vehicle identification technologies. Automatic Number Plate Recognition (ANPR) systems use advanced cameras, optical character recognition software, artificial intelligence, and image processing technologies to detect and record vehicle registration numbers in real time. These systems are widely deployed across traffic management, law enforcement, electronic toll collection, parking management, access control, and border monitoring applications.
The market is experiencing strong growth due to rising urbanization, increasing vehicle ownership, and the growing adoption of AI-powered surveillance systems across smart city infrastructure. ANPR systems are becoming an essential part of intelligent transportation ecosystems, enabling real-time monitoring, improved enforcement efficiency, and enhanced traffic control capabilities.

Market Size and Forecast
The global Automatic Number Plate Recognition Systems Market size was valued at USD 4.92 billion in 2025 and is projected to reach USD 5.41 billion in 2026. By 2034, the market is expected to reach USD 12.84 billion, growing at a CAGR of 11.42% during the forecast period from 2025 to 2034.
This growth is supported by increasing investments in intelligent transportation systems, rising demand for automated traffic enforcement, and rapid digital transformation in public safety infrastructure. The integration of artificial intelligence and cloud-based analytics is further accelerating the adoption of ANPR systems across developed and emerging economies.
Market Drivers
Rising Investments in Smart City Infrastructure
A major driver of the Automatic Number Plate Recognition Systems Market is the growing investment in smart city development projects worldwide. Governments are focusing on building intelligent transportation systems that improve mobility, reduce congestion, and enhance public safety. ANPR technology plays a central role in these systems by enabling automated vehicle identification and real-time traffic monitoring.
These systems are increasingly integrated with surveillance networks, traffic control centers, and urban mobility platforms. This allows authorities to manage traffic flow efficiently, support law enforcement operations, and improve urban planning decisions based on real-time vehicle data.
Growing Need for Automated Traffic Enforcement
Another key driver is the rising demand for automated traffic enforcement solutions. Increasing vehicle ownership and traffic congestion have made manual enforcement methods less effective. ANPR systems help authorities detect violations such as speeding, illegal parking, toll evasion, and unauthorized access with high accuracy.
These systems reduce reliance on human monitoring, improve enforcement consistency, and generate digital evidence for violation processing. As a result, transportation authorities are increasingly deploying ANPR solutions to improve road safety and operational efficiency.

Market Challenges
Data Privacy and Regulatory Compliance Concerns
Despite strong growth potential, the market faces challenges related to data privacy and regulatory compliance. ANPR systems collect and store large volumes of vehicle identification data, which is subject to strict regulations regarding data usage, storage, and retention.
Governments across various regions are strengthening privacy laws to ensure responsible use of surveillance technologies. This requires organizations to invest in cybersecurity measures and compliance frameworks. Public concerns over surveillance practices may also slow adoption in certain regions, increasing implementation complexity and operational costs.
Market Opportunities
Expansion of Intelligent Transportation Systems
The expansion of intelligent transportation systems presents significant growth opportunities for the Automatic Number Plate Recognition Systems Market. ANPR technology is a core component of these systems, supporting applications such as congestion management, vehicle tracking, incident detection, and automated toll collection.
As governments continue to modernize transportation infrastructure, demand for integrated ANPR solutions is expected to rise. The increasing focus on smart mobility and connected road networks further strengthens the market outlook.
Increasing Demand for Automated Parking Management Solutions
Another major opportunity lies in automated parking management systems. ANPR technology is widely used in parking facilities to enable contactless entry and exit, automated ticketing, and real-time vehicle tracking.
Commercial complexes, airports, residential communities, and smart city projects are increasingly adopting these systems to improve parking efficiency and reduce congestion. This growing demand is expected to significantly contribute to market expansion in the coming years.
Market Segmentation
By Component
The hardware segment dominated the market with a 46.72% share in 2025 due to its essential role in capturing and processing vehicle data. Cameras, sensors, infrared illuminators, and processing units form the backbone of ANPR systems.
The software segment is expected to grow at the fastest CAGR of 13.84% through 2034, driven by increasing adoption of artificial intelligence, machine learning, and cloud-based analytics for improved recognition accuracy and operational efficiency.
The market includes hardware, software, and services segments.
By Application
Traffic management held the largest share of 38.61% in 2025 due to widespread use of ANPR systems in monitoring traffic flow, detecting violations, and supporting urban transportation planning.
Parking management is expected to grow at the fastest CAGR of 14.12% during the forecast period due to increasing demand for automated parking infrastructure and contactless vehicle access systems.
Applications include traffic management, law enforcement, electronic toll collection, parking management, and access control.
By End User
Government and law enforcement agencies dominated the market with a 49.83% share in 2025 due to extensive use of ANPR systems in traffic enforcement, surveillance, and criminal investigations.
Commercial enterprises are expected to grow at the fastest CAGR of 13.67% as businesses adopt ANPR systems for access control, parking management, and operational efficiency.
End users include government and law enforcement, transportation authorities, commercial enterprises, and parking operators.
By Deployment Type
Fixed ANPR systems dominated the market with a 57.44% share in 2025 due to widespread deployment across highways, urban roads, toll booths, and security checkpoints.
The market also includes mobile ANPR systems and portable ANPR systems used for flexible and temporary monitoring applications.
Regional Analysis
North America
North America accounted for 35.84% of the market in 2025 and is projected to grow at a CAGR of 11.18% through 2034. Strong investments in intelligent transportation systems and advanced surveillance infrastructure support regional growth. The United States remains the dominant country due to widespread deployment of connected traffic monitoring systems.
Europe
Europe held a 28.47% market share in 2025 and is expected to grow at a CAGR of 10.74%. The region benefits from advanced transportation networks and strong adoption of smart mobility solutions. Germany leads the regional market due to advanced transportation infrastructure and smart city initiatives.
Asia Pacific
Asia Pacific accounted for 24.61% of the market in 2025 and is expected to register the fastest CAGR of 13.26% through 2034. Rapid urbanization, increasing vehicle ownership, and large-scale smart city projects are driving growth. China dominates the regional market due to extensive surveillance infrastructure and smart city investments.
Middle East & Africa
The Middle East & Africa held a 5.86% market share in 2025 and is projected to grow at a CAGR of 10.31%. Investments in smart infrastructure and transportation modernization are driving adoption. The United Arab Emirates leads the regional market.
Latin America
Latin America accounted for 5.22% of the market in 2025 and is expected to grow at a CAGR of 10.02%. Brazil dominates the region due to expanding transportation infrastructure and adoption of automated toll collection systems.
